Hi Soren — handing off OCT-1142, the websocket reconnect bug in Lanternfeed. Clients reconnecting after token expiry briefly reuse the stale session, which is why this is flagged for security review. I added logging around the handshake and a temporary forced re-auth. Repro steps are in the ticket. For review questions, the feed team contact is below.

alerts address for bajop-yahog: istwyn@lumiclabs.internal

## Authentication

The Ferrowatch firmware channel accepts signed update manifests only. Devices authenticate with a per-fleet credential; the CI pipeline authenticates with a publisher credential scoped to upload-only. Rotation is monthly, automated. Review note: the updater rejects any manifest older than 48 hours, so don't cache builds. Staging uploads for this review should use the bearer token below.

session JWT of yawep-yawep = eyJhbGciOiJIUzI1NiIsInR5cCI6IkpXVCJ9.eyJzdWIiOiI3pWF3_In0.aXYsHiog

**Q: How does the Scanbright barcode integration work, and what if it stops decoding?**

The Scanbright adapter listens on the Wrenfield device bus and normalizes symbologies before handing payloads to the inventory service. If decoding fails, first check the firmware map table — most issues are stale symbology mappings after a scanner firmware update. Re-provisioning a scanner requires pulling its pairing certificate from the hardware credentials vault, which is unlocked with the recovery passphrase below.

recovery phrase for hahip-hahaf: aldvan-oliok-silael-quenmir-aldix-praix-eliox-eliion-zorwyn-normir

**Alert: ExportRetryBacklogHigh**

The Parcelforge export service has more than 200 failed exports awaiting retry for over 15 minutes. This usually means the downstream Driftbox archive is rejecting uploads, often after a credential rotation. Retries back off exponentially, so the queue drains slowly once the cause clears. Check recent Driftbox deploys first, then manually requeue stuck exports if the backlog exceeds an hour. Do not purge the retry queue. Remediation steps and the requeue command are documented on the page below.

runbook for badug-kadup: https://confluence.zemvarlabs.internal/projects/browse/display/projects/bd1b